London’s off-street sex industry

London Revealed: the truth about brothels
A survey into London’s off-street sex industry has exposed just how widespread it is.

In Julie Bindel’s recent 2008 off-line brothel report, she finds that the business of sex is flourishing. The study was conducted through 120 hours of telephone calls to London’s brothel workers. She states that “at least 1,933 women are at work in London’s brothels; ages range from 18 to 55 (with several premises offering “very, very young girls. I would imagine that many of these Brothels have an online component (including webcams) to their business model.

Many of the businesses (85%) conduct their business in residential areas. “Almost two-thirds are located in flats and more than one-fifth are in a house. Wherever you are in the city, the likelihood is that buying and selling women is going on under your nose.”
“Our researchers contacted only brothels that advertised in local newspapers – not those that advertise on websites or on cards in telephone boxes. Because of this we only uncovered the tiniest corner of the trade. But we still encountered brothels in every London borough, with Enfield (a typical residential area of north London) having a minimum of 54, and Westminster at least 71. We estimated that the brothels we surveyed made anything from £86m to £209.5m in total per year through newspaper advertisements alone.”

India

Pornography in India is illegal and attracts several penal provisions. However, enforcement is extremely lax and pornographic materials are easily available. The law also states that only the distribution of pornography is illegal, while its creation and gaining access to it is not. Therefore, it is legal to access a pornographic site hosted on non-Indian servers. Pornographic films in India are called Blue Films and are available virtually anywhere; especially in areas where pirated material is already being sold.

Online Porn

Latest and one of the fastest growing online porn company – built what is arguably the country’s most successful fetish porn company, Kink.com

New York Times article states that “Acworth has since built what is arguably the country’s most successful fetish porn company, Kink.com — a fast-growing suite of 10 S-and-M and bondage-themed Web sites, each updated weekly with a new half-hour or hour video segment. Kink has 60,000 subscribers; access to each site costs about $30 a month. Acworth founded Kink’s first site, Hogtied, while still at Columbia. He purchased licensed digital photographs for content, many of which were simply old bondage-magazine spreads, torn out and scanned. Almost immediately, Hogtied made several hundred dollars a day — then, with a few ads in place, more than a thousand.”
